Clare Gardaí Out In Force As Project EDWARD Kicks Into Action

Clare Gardaí will be out in force on the county’s roads today, as part of the ‘European Day Without A Road Death’.

Project EDWARD as it’s known – is held every September and aims to promote a a message of safe driving by avoiding any fatal crashes on the continent today.

The campaign, which is being run by TISPOL – the European Traffic Police Network – kicked into effect at midnight and will run right throughout today.
